Top 5 Best West Virginia Christian Private High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 22 christian private high schools serving 3,068 students in West Virginia. You can also find more religiously affiliated schools in West Virginia.
The top ranked christian private high schools in West Virginia include Grace Christian School, Teays Valley Christian School and Faith Christian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 97%, which is higher than the West Virginia private high school average acceptance rate of 92%.
